World Bank Board approved 6.5 billion for Pakistan under the Country Assistance Strategy (CAS)

 

The World Bank Board of Directors approved 6.5billion for Pakistan under the Country Assistance Strategy (CAS) which is an expression of confidence of the World Bank on Pakistan 's economy and the policies being pursued by the government.

Mr. John Wall, World Bank Country Director of Pakistan has said that Pakistan has moved from crisis to growth, laying the groundwork for sustained growth and significant poverty reduction. The strategy is designed to help Pakistan prosper, he said.

The Board of Executive Directors approved assistance of US$3 billion under IDA and the remaining US$3 billion would be provided under IBRD. Besides approving Country Assistance Strategy for Pakistan, the Board of Executive Directors also approved four new projects totaling US$340 million: NWFP First Development Policy Credit (IDA$90 million), Punjab Education Development Policy Credit (IDA $100 million), Punjab Irrigation Sector Development Policy Loan (IBRD $100 million) and the Punjab Municipal Services Improvement Loan (IBRD $50 million).

Later, after the meeting, a signing ceremony was held at the World Bank office. Mr. John Wall, Country Director Pakistan signed the document on behalf of the World Bank and Mr. Mushtaq Malik, Economic Minister, Embassy of Pakistan signed on behalf of the Government of Pakistan.

The Board's members, in their written statements, appreciated Pakistan 's outstanding economic performance and reposed their confidence in the current monetary and fiscal policies of the Government of Pakistan.
